In a city swallowed by chaos and decay, where shadows took on a life of their own and the air was thick with the scent of fear, Ada Wong moved like a whisper, a figure draped in crimson and mystery. Her sleek, black dress clung to her form, highlighting the deadly elegance that was both captivating and unnerving. Many had tried to decipher the enigmatic woman, yet her motives danced just beyond the reach of perception. What drove her through the labyrinthine streets, lit only by flickering street lamps and the eerie glow of neon signs, was a mixture of desperation and sheer determination. The mission she embarked upon tonight was fraught with peril, set within the sterile walls of a bio-weapons lab that the world had forgotten.

The lab, shrouded in layers of barbed wire and guarded by vigilant eyes, was a monument to mankind’s hubris, a place where science flirted dangerously with madness. Rumors of experimental strains of the T-Virus and grotesque creatures prowling the hallways had reached Ada’s ears, and with it, an undeniable allure. Inside, whispers of power lay dormant, waiting to be unearthed, and Ada was just the thief to slip through the cracks.

Employing a blend of stealth and preternatural agility, she scaled the outer wall, her gloved hands finding purchase on the crumbling ledge. The moonlight revealed the broad expanse of the lab’s roof, its surface slick with moisture from the evening chill. Carefully, she maneuvered across, listening to the distant sounds of mechanical whirs and the low hum of generators. It was a place that breathed danger; she could feel it in her bones.

Crouching beside a ventilation shaft, she took a moment to gather her thoughts. Inside lay the heart of the beast—a research center where humanity’s darkest curiosities had birthed warped abominations. If half of what she had heard was true, then these corridors were far from empty. With a final glance at the horizon, where city lights flickered like dying stars, Ada unlatched the grating and slipped inside the shaft.

It was dark, the stale air clinging to her like a shroud. She crawled through the narrow confines, each movement deliberate, the echo of her own heartbeat a reminder of vulnerability. The maze of ductwork eventually opened into a dimly-lit corridor, the metallic scent of blood—both fresh and old—mingling with the acrid odor of chemicals. The walls were stark white, almost blinding under the fluorescent lights that buzzed erratically overhead, illuminating the thoroughfare into a realm of nightmares.

A brief glance revealed shattered glass and ominous silhouettes lingering at the far end of the hall. Ada took cover, pressing her back against the cold wall, her training kicking in as she assessed her surroundings. The reports had mentioned security teams, but the real threat seemed to lurk in the shadows—creatures borne of twisted experiments, each more horrifying than the last.

Several muffled growls echoed through the corridor, reverberating in her chest like distant thunder. A figure emerged from the darkness, stumbling with an unnatural gait, its skin a sickly green hue glistening in the flickering lights. It was a man—sort of. The remnants of his humanity struggled against the monstrous transformation that had overtaken him, flesh ripped and torn, revealing gnashing teeth and vacant eyes filled with primal hunger.

Dread knotted in Ada’s stomach, but she steadied herself. Regaining a semblance of control, she drew her gun, the weight of it familiar and reassuring. Every moment counted; hesitation could mean the difference between life and death. As the creature drew closer, lurching forward with a guttural sound that resonated through the hallway, Ada acted, her movements fluid like molasses dripped in honey.

The silenced bullet found its mark, striking the creature in the head with impeccable precision. It collapsed, crumpling to the ground in a heap of twisted limbs. Ada took a deep breath, allowing herself just a heartbeat of respite before continuing further down the corridor, stepping over the body with careful ease.

Every corner held secrets, every turn a potential ambush. She pressed on, sensing the oppressive atmosphere settling deeper around her like a fog. A lingering chill ran down her spine as she passed through a series of reinforced doors, each one a barrier between her and the secrets contained within.
